How long does a flight from Islamabad to Scotland take?

The duration of a flight to Scotland depends on your arrival airport. The shortest routes to Scotland from Islamabad are to Aberdeen, which takes 23h 35m, and Edinburgh, which takes 30h 40m.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Islamabad to Scotland?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Islamabad to Scotland with an airline and back with another airline.
